Turbo Air RBDO-43 Technical Specs
The Turbo Air RBDO-43 features a three-deck electric configuration with independent top and bottom heating controls, powered at 220V three-phase with a current draw of 65 amps (total 220V/60Hz). Its self-contained structure incorporates European pan compatibility (16"x24") and is constructed of stainless steel for durability and sanitation. Operating within a temperature range suitable for bread, pastry, and savory baked goods, it incorporates ETL and cETLus certifications, ensuring safety and compliance. Weighing approximately 1,579 lbs, this oven measures 64.5" wide by 43.75" deep and 74.25" tall, supported by adjustable legs and casters for versatile placement. Its panel features integrated microprocessor controls for precise and repeatable baking cycles, with overheat sensors safeguarding operation. Maintenance is simplified through accessible components, supporting efficient workflows in busy commercial kitchens.
- Electrical requirements: 220V, 3-phase, 65 amps, 220V/60Hz
- Construction materials: Stainless steel exterior and interior for durability and sanitation
- Weight: 1579 lbs
- Dimensions: 64.5" W x 43.75" D x 74.25" H
- Temperature range: Suitable for standard baking applications from moderate temperatures upwards
- Certification: ETL and cETLus

What is a commercial deck oven
A commercial deck oven is a multi-tiered baking appliance designed for high-capacity culinary production. Typically installed in professional bakery or restaurant settings, it provides independent heat zones via top and bottom elements to achieve even baking results.
